shelving
Version:
Toolkit for using data in JavaScript.
29 lines (25 loc) • 605 B
CSS
@import "../style/base.css";
@layer components {
.paragraph,
.prose p {
display: block;
inline-size: 100%;
margin-inline: 0;
margin-block: var(--paragraph-spacing, var(--spacing-paragraph));
/* Typography — inherits `color` from the page baseline or a `.text-X` variant on this element or an ancestor. */
font-family: var(--paragraph-font, inherit);
font-size: var(--paragraph-size, inherit);
text-align: var(--paragraph-align, left);
}
}
@layer overrides {
.paragraph,
.prose p {
&:first-child {
margin-block-start: 0;
}
&:last-child {
margin-block-end: 0;
}
}
}